The Champaign City Council primary election held Tuesday has set the stage for three current council members and three new comers to face off in a general election on April 17.

The six candidates will run for the three at-large seats in the April general election. Current council members Deborah Frank Feinen, Tom Bruno and Giraldo Rosales will all be on the general election ballot. The newcomers include Karen Foster, Patricia Avery and Annette Williams.

The official results will not be in for two weeks due to absentee ballots and provisional votes but, the outcome will not change, said Mark Shelden, county clerk for Champaign County.

Bill Glithero, Michael Henley and Freddie Gordon lost the primary election and will not appear on the ballot in April.
